Output f3f1d39aa4efea1c6cc96bee75813f5ca7fddbc371bc0edcf897c88affa130e5:1

value
24448016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 161ceea1f883dca4a4f6c5d77c6704edde7d179e OP_EQUAL
address
33hwT1HL5iUod23L4NRqwyRKD8fKz9khks
transaction
f3f1d39aa4efea1c6cc96bee75813f5ca7fddbc371bc0edcf897c88affa130e5
confirmations
274286
spent
true